Web Hosting: A Comprehensive Guide

Web hosting is a fundamental component for any website or online business. It is the service that provides the necessary infrastructure and storage for your website's files, enabling it to be accessible to users on the internet. Choosing the right web hosting provider is crucial for ensuring your website's performance, reliability, and security.

**Types of Web Hosting**

There are several types of web hosting available, each offering different levels of performance and features:

* **Shared Hosting:** The most basic type, where multiple websites share the same server resources. It is affordable and suitable for small websites with low traffic.
* **VPS Hosting (Virtual Private Server):** Provides dedicated, isolated virtual server resources within a shared physical server. It offers more control and flexibility than shared hosting.
* **Dedicated Hosting:** A dedicated physical server exclusively for your website, providing maximum performance, control, and security. It is suitable for high-traffic websites or those requiring specialized configurations.
* **Cloud Hosting:** Utilizes multiple interconnected servers to host websites, providing scalability and reliability. It allows you to easily adjust resources as needed.

**Factors to Consider When Choosing a Web Host**

When selecting a web hosting provider, consider the following factors:

* **Uptime:** The percentage of time your website is accessible to users. Look for providers with high uptime guarantees (99.9% or higher).
* **Bandwidth:** The amount of data that can be transferred to and from your website. Choose a provider with sufficient bandwidth capacity to handle your expected traffic.
* **Storage:** The amount of space available for storing your website's files, databases, and emails.
* **Customer Support:** The quality and availability of support provided by the hosting provider. Look for 24/7 support and knowledgeable representatives.
* **Security:** The measures in place to protect your website and data from unauthorized access or attacks. Consider providers with SSL certificates, firewalls, and intrusion detection systems.

**Tips for Choosing a Web Hosting Provider**

* **Research and Compare:** Read reviews, compare pricing and features, and seek recommendations from other website owners.
* **Consider Your Website's Needs:** Determine the type of hosting, bandwidth, storage, and security features that your website requires.
* **Check Uptime and Reliability:** Look for providers with proven track records of high uptime and minimal outages.
* **Test Customer Support:** Contact the support team to assess their responsiveness and problem-solving abilities.
* **Read the Service Level Agreement (SLA):** Understand the terms and conditions of the hosting service, including uptime guarantees and customer support obligations.

**Additional Tips for Web Hosting**

* **Optimize Your Website:** Use caching, compression, and other techniques to reduce load times and improve website performance.
* **Regularly Update Content:** Keep your website fresh and relevant by regularly adding new content and updating existing content.
* **Secure Your Website:** Install SSL certificates, implement firewalls, and regularly scan for vulnerabilities to protect your website from threats.
* **Monitor Your Website:** Use tools to monitor website traffic, uptime, and performance to identify any issues and address them promptly.
* **Backup Your Website:** Regularly backup your website's files and databases to protect your data in case of server failures or accidents.

Add a Comment